Robert Lindsey assists privately held companies as well as public corporations in a wide variety of corporate and transactional matters, including commercial transactions and mergers and acquisitions. He has significant experience preparing and reviewing deal transactions including stock purchase agreements, asset purchase agreements, limited guarantees and contribution and exchange agreements.

Robert also represents companies in commercial contracts, such as the drafting and negotiation of license and subscription agreements, distribution agreements, consulting agreements, equipment leases and clinical trial agreements.

Robert earned his Juris Doctor degree from Harvard Law School where he served as the executive editor for the Harvard Business Law Review as well as the Harvard Negotiation Law Review. Robert served as a chairman for the Harvard Association for Law and Business, where he was responsible for helping students learn about in-house counsel roles and opportunities. He earned his Bachelor of Arts degree from the University of Maryland.
